Cincinnati flash flooding: MSD responding to hundreds of sewer backup reports

Two weeks after historic flash flooding struck the Tri-State, Cincinnati is still recovering as the Metropolitan Sewer District (MSD) works through hundreds of sewer backup reports and Hamilton County’s emergency management agency continues to assess damage.

MSD has received more than 1,800 reports since the storms and more than 900 of them have met eligibility requirements for cleaning services through the agency’s sewer backup program.

“Those are people calling us saying they have water in their basement or they believe they have a sewer backup, and then we are going out and investigating those,” MSD Director Diana Christy said…
